Description
3 children rescued from a Pennsylvania home were so emaciated they looked like concentration camp survivors, a prosecutor said. Joshua and Brandi Weyant admitted to starving the 4, 5, and 6 year olds to the point that they were eating paint chips. Nancy Grace digs into this case with Juvenile Judge Ashley Willcott, forensic expert Joseph Scott Morgan, psychologist Dr. Tiffany Sanders, and RadarOnline reporter Alexis Tereszcuk. Grace is also joined by school law attorney Andrea Tytell and reporter John Lemley to discuss the latest in the Parkland, Florida, school shooting.
